人妻丝袜美腿中文字幕乱一区三区-天天爽夜夜爽夜夜爽-摸 透 干 奶 流 操 逼-中文字幕一区二区色婷婷-免费特黄一级欧美大片在线看-91久久福利国产成人精品-久久精品人人爽人人做97-亚洲深喉一区二区在线看片-久久中文字幕无码不卡

緩存是什么

1、緩存(cache),原始意義是指訪問速度比一般隨機(jī)存取存儲器(RAM)快的一種高速存儲器,通常它不像系統(tǒng)主存那樣使用DRAM技術(shù),而使用昂貴但較快速的SRAM技術(shù) 。緩存的設(shè)置是所有現(xiàn)代計算機(jī)系統(tǒng)發(fā)揮高性能的重要因素之一 。
【緩存是什么】2、緩存是指可以進(jìn)行高速數(shù)據(jù)交換的存儲器,它先于內(nèi)存與CPU交換數(shù)據(jù),因此速率很快 。L1 Cache(一級緩存)是CPU第一層高速緩存 。內(nèi)置的L1高速緩存的容量和結(jié)構(gòu)對CPU的性能影響較大 , 不過高速緩沖存儲器均由靜態(tài)RAM組成,結(jié)構(gòu)較復(fù)雜,在CPU管芯面積不能太大的情況下 , L1級高速緩存的容量不可能做得太大 。一般L1緩存的容量通常在32—256KB 。L2 Cache(二級緩存)是CPU的第二層高速緩存,分內(nèi)部和外部兩種芯片 。內(nèi)部的芯片二級緩存運(yùn)行速率與主頻相同 , 而外部的二級緩存則只有主頻的一半 。
3、L2高速緩存容量也會影響CPU的性能,原則是越大越好,普通臺式機(jī)CPU的L2緩存一般為128KB到2MB或者更高,筆記本、服務(wù)器和工作站上用CPU的L2高速緩存最高可達(dá)1MB-3MB 。由于高速緩存的速度越高價格也越貴,故有的計算機(jī)系統(tǒng)中設(shè)置了兩級或多級高速緩存 。緊靠內(nèi)存的一級高速緩存的速度最高,而容量最小 , 二級高速緩存的容量稍大,速度也稍低。
4、緩存只是內(nèi)存中少部分?jǐn)?shù)據(jù)的復(fù)制品 , 所以CPU到緩存中尋找數(shù)據(jù)時,也會出現(xiàn)找不到的情況(因?yàn)檫@些數(shù)據(jù)沒有從內(nèi)存復(fù)制到緩存中去),這時CPU還是會到內(nèi)存中去找數(shù)據(jù),這樣系統(tǒng)的速率就慢下來了,不過CPU會把這些數(shù)據(jù)復(fù)制到緩存中去 , 以便下一次不要再到內(nèi)存中去取 。隨著時間的變化,被訪問得最頻繁的數(shù)據(jù)不是一成不變的,也就是說 , 剛才還不頻繁的數(shù)據(jù),此時已經(jīng)需要被頻繁的訪問,剛才還是最頻繁的數(shù)據(jù),又不頻繁了,所以說緩存中的數(shù)據(jù)要經(jīng)常按照一定的算法來更換,這樣才能保證緩存中的數(shù)據(jù)是被訪問最頻繁的 。

    推薦閱讀